
Gorillas Beat Thunder
Published on November 28, 2009 under Central Hockey League (CHL)
Wichita Thunder News Release
WICHITA, KS- The Wichita Thunder lost 4-2 to the Amarillo Gorillas at the Kansas Coliseum on Saturday night. Mike Kneeland roofed his fourth goal of the year at 8:53 in the first to give the Thunder a 1-0 lead. Amarillo rallied for two goals 45 seconds apart at 14:44 and 15:29 in the first to move in front 2-1.
Joe Guenther and Chris Cloud both scored on rebounds in the second, completing a run of four unanswered Gorillas' goals. Jason Deleurme cut the lead to 4-2 with a power play goal at 16:01. Amarillo added a goal from Jake Morissette at 18:59 in the third to make it 5-2.
Mike Batovanja earned his team-leading seventh fighting major of the season, dropping the gloves two seconds into the game off the opening faceoff. Wichita outshot Amarillo 36-27. The Thunder went 1 for 6 on the power play, while going 5 for 5 on the penalty kill. Jon Horrell took the loss, saving 22 of 27.
